GC syringes are a critical tool in the field of research, especially in analytical laboratories focused on chemical analysis and experimentation. In this application, GC syringes are employed in gas chromatography, where their precision is key to obtaining reliable results during the separation and analysis of chemical compounds. Researchers rely on GC syringes for accurate measurement and injection of samples into gas chromatographs, ensuring that experiments produce high-quality data. Additionally, the versatility of GC syringes, which are available in various sizes and configurations, makes them suitable for a broad range of scientific disciplines, including chemistry, environmental analysis, and forensic science.

The "Other" application category encompasses a diverse range of industries where GC syringes are used, from food and beverage testing to environmental monitoring. In these sectors, GC syringes are integral to ensuring the accuracy of sample collection and analysis. For instance, in the food industry, GC syringes are used to test for contaminants, measure flavor compounds, and assess the quality of ingredients. Similarly, in environmental monitoring, GC syringes are employed to analyze air and water samples, detecting pollutants and ensuring regulatory compliance. Their ability to handle minute quantities of substances with precision makes them valuable across various fields that require high-quality analytical results.

1. What is the primary use of GC syringes?
GC syringes are primarily used for precise sample injection in gas chromatography, ensuring accurate analysis of chemical compounds.
2. What industries benefit most from GC syringes?
The pharmaceutical, research, and environmental industries benefit the most due to the syringes' precision and reliability in analytical applications.
3. How do GC syringes contribute to pharmaceutical research?
GC syringes are essential in pharmaceutical research for precise drug testing, formulation, and quality control, ensuring regulatory compliance and safety.
4. Are there different types of GC syringes?
Yes, GC syringes come in various sizes and configurations to meet different analytical and sampling needs in diverse sectors.
5. How has automation impacted the GC syringes market?
Automation has increased the efficiency and precision of GC syringe usage, reducing human error and improving throughput in laboratories.
6. What are the key materials used in GC syringes?
GC syringes are typically made from high-quality stainless steel, glass, and advanced polymers to ensure durability and resistance to harsh chemicals.
